With the rating of 95 given to Lovely Carrig on handicap debut looking a little harsh, AN DROICHEAD GORM can get off the mark for connections at the fifth time of asking over the larger obstacles. The six-year-old was reportedly 'never travelling' on his last start at Fairyhouse last month but can build on a promising run on handicap debut at Galway in October. Bottom weight, Mr Bolt can emerge as the biggest danger in first-time blinkers to assist the veteran 14-year-old. Golden Sunset and Highest Benefit are not out of it in a competitive handicap.
